โ€ข Fundamentals of Nanomaterial Design: An introduction to the basics of nanomaterial design, including the unique properties of nanomaterials and their potential applications. This unit will provide a solid foundation for the rest of the course.
โ€ข Synthesis Techniques for Nanomaterials: A comprehensive overview of the various methods used to synthesize nanomaterials, including physical, chemical, and biological techniques. This unit will cover the advantages and disadvantages of each method, as well as their optimal conditions and applications.
โ€ข Nanomaterial Characterization Techniques: An exploration of the various techniques used to characterize nanomaterials, including microscopy, spectroscopy, and scattering techniques. This unit will provide an understanding of how to determine the physical and chemical properties of nanomaterials.
โ€ข Computational Modeling and Simulation: An introduction to the use of computational modeling and simulation in nanomaterial design. This unit will cover the basics of molecular dynamics simulations, density functional theory, and other computational techniques used to predict the properties of nanomaterials.
โ€ข Applications of Nanomaterials in Industry: An examination of the various applications of nanomaterials in industry, including electronics, energy, healthcare, and environmental remediation. This unit will provide real-world examples of how nanomaterials are being used to solve complex problems.
โ€ข Nanomaterial Safety and Regulatory Compliance: A discussion of the safety and regulatory considerations associated with nanomaterials, including the potential health risks and the regulatory frameworks governing their use. This unit will provide an understanding of how to ensure the safe and responsible use of nanomaterials.
โ€ข Emerging Trends in Nanomaterial Design: An exploration of the latest trends and developments in nanomaterial design, including the use of artificial intelligence, machine learning, and other cutting-edge technologies. This unit will provide a glimpse into the future of nanomaterial design and its potential impact on industry.
